在AIML,有什么文件有效的方式来使用的元素 <set name="“it”">?
-
01-07-2019 - |
题
在文件原子.aiml,部分 附加说明的爱丽丝AIML文件, 有很多类似这样的:
<category>
<pattern>ANSWER MY QUESTION</pattern>
<template>
Please try asking
<set name="it">your question</set>
another way.
</template>
</category>
这种代码不是有效的根据 AIML划;验证程序说 没有字的数据是允许的内容模型 (关于 你的问题 字数据集的元素)。如果我删除 你的问题 错误消失,但随后"它",不是定义的正确。
我怎么修复上述代码所以它通过验证?
解决方案
这验证程序您使用的是因为下列完整的文件证据了xerces?
<aiml xmlns="http://alicebot.org/2001/AIML-1.0.1" version="1.0.1">
<category>
<pattern>ANSWER MY QUESTION</pattern>
<template>
Please try asking
<set name="it">your question</set>
another way.
</template>
</category>
</aiml>
不隶属于 StackOverflow